South Shore Health is pleased to announce a record-setting $100,000 presenting sponsorship from Alan McKim for the upcoming South Shore Health Gala, scheduled for Friday, Oct. 17 at the Marriott Boston Quincy. 

This extraordinary commitment marks the largest presenting sponsorship in the event’s history and highlights McKim’s continued dedication to advancing health care on the South Shore.

McKim’s latest gift builds on the ongoing generosity of the McKim Family Foundation – inclusive of a recent $5.3 million transformational gift to South Shore Hospital. 

That philanthropic milestone is already fueling significant enhancements to the Emergency Department and Level II Trauma Center, which serve thousands of patients each year.

“A gift of this scale redefines what is possible for the gala, and for South Shore Health as a whole,” said Allen Smith, MD, MS, President and CEO of South Shore Health. “Alan’s profound impact can be felt across our entire health system, from emergency and cancer care to critical facility upgrades. His leadership and generosity set a powerful example and inspire our community to take action.” 

Founder and former CEO of Clean Harbors and a longtime South Shore resident, McKim has supported South Shore Health for more than 17 years. 

His philanthropy has helped drive many signature initiatives, including the Emerson building expansion, the Dana-Farber Brigham Cancer Center at South Shore Health, and the Richard and Joann Aubut Critical Care Unit. 

The McKim Family Main Entrance at South Shore Hospital stands as a testament to his family’s enduring generosity.

“Alan McKim is a true champion of South Shore Health’s mission to provide high-quality, compassionate, and connected care close to home,” said Lauren Spencer, Senior Vice President and Chief Development Officer, South Shore Health. “His record Gala sponsorship, along with his history of visionary giving, is an investment in our future and our community’s well-being.”

The South Shore Health Gala supports critical emergency and trauma services, including the emergency department, the Mobile Integrated Health (MIH) Program, and the trauma center. 

With McKim’s extraordinary sponsorship, the 2025 Gala is poised to reach new heights in fundraising and impact.
